Glassware production process

Glassware production process Pre-processing of raw materials. Crush the bulk raw materials (quartz sand, soda ash, limestone, feldspar, etc.) to dry the wet raw materials, and remove the iron from the iron-containing raw materials to ensure the quality of the glass.
